What Your Bike Shop Website in Tacoma Must Include
A Tacoma Bike Shop website must prioritize immediate utility for local riders. Implement schema markup for 'BikeShop' and 'LocalBusiness' specifically detailing services like 'bike repair Tacoma', 'e-bike sales Tacoma', and 'bike fitting Tacoma' to aid search engines. Crucially, integrate 'opening hours' and 'location' schema, particularly for shops serving areas like Hilltop or Stadium District, as riders often search for immediate needs. Your site needs a dedicated page for common repairs with transparent pricing, reflecting the planned search intent of most bike service queries. Displaying affiliations with local cycling clubs or events, like those organized by the Tacoma Bicycle Club, signals community engagement and builds trust, a critical E-E-A-T factor. Ensure your contact information is above the fold, including a click-to-call button, as mobile searches for bike shops are prevalent, especially during riding season. Common Website Mistakes Tacoma Bike Shops Make
Many Tacoma Bike Shops make fundamental errors that cripple their online visibility. First, neglecting mobile optimization: with 65% of Tacoma bike searches on mobile, a non-responsive site immediately alienates a majority of potential customers. Second, failing to implement local schema markup means Google struggles to connect their services to specific Tacoma neighborhoods or landmarks, diminishing local search rankings. Third, most sites lack detailed, unique content for specific services like 'e-bike battery diagnostics Tacoma' or 'custom bike builds Tacoma', causing them to lose out on long-tail keyword traffic. Fourth, many Bike Shops in Tacoma fail to integrate customer reviews prominently, undermining crucial social proof and E-E-A-T signals. Do Bike Shops in Tacoma need a website or can they use a directory listing?
While directory listings like Yelp or Google Business Profile are essential, relying solely on them is a critical mistake for a Tacoma Bike Shop. These platforms offer limited control over branding, content, and direct customer engagement. A dedicated website allows you to showcase unique services like custom bike fitting or specialized e-bike repair, build trust through detailed content, and capture leads directly.
